Fundamentals 2 min read

2018 Web Developer Learning Roadmap – Translation and Overview

This article shares a translated version of a 2018 web developer learning roadmap originally compiled by Kamran Ahmed, covering front‑end technologies, back‑end technologies, and DevOps, and provides links to the original GitHub resources for further reference.

Java Captain
Java Captain
Java Captain
2018 Web Developer Learning Roadmap – Translation and Overview

This article presents a translated version of the 2018 Web Developer Learning Roadmap originally created by Kamran Ahmed, with links to both the original English repository and the Chinese translation.

0. Introduction

The roadmap outlines the essential knowledge areas for becoming a professional web developer in 2018.

1. Frontend Technologies

The first section focuses on front‑end development, illustrating key skills and tools with an image.

2. Backend Technologies

The second section covers back‑end development, again visualized with an image.

3. DevOps

The final technical area is DevOps, presented with a corresponding diagram.

Original author: kamranahmedse (GitHub: developer-roadmap ). Translation author: 小克 (GitHub: developer-roadmap-chinese ).

backendfrontenddevopsweb developmentRoadmap
Java Captain
Written by

Java Captain

Focused on Java technologies: SSM, the Spring ecosystem, microservices, MySQL, MyCat, clustering, distributed systems, middleware, Linux, networking, multithreading; occasionally covers DevOps tools like Jenkins, Nexus, Docker, ELK; shares practical tech insights and is dedicated to full‑stack Java development.

0 followers
Reader feedback

How this landed with the community

login Sign in to like

Rate this article

Was this worth your time?

Sign in to rate
Discussion

0 Comments

Thoughtful readers leave field notes, pushback, and hard-won operational detail here.